About This Book

What if you could turn plain metal into amazing creations with just your hands and a few tools? Imagine building a magnetic maze that twists and turns or designing shoes with cool metal springs for laces. Every project lets you shape, bend, and polish metal into something totally unique—but can you master the tools to make it all work?

Quick Assessment

This engaging book introduces young readers to basic metalworking projects with simple, step-by-step instructions and clear photographs. Designed for early readers ages 5-8, it encourages creativity, fine motor skills, and an interest in engineering with safe, age-appropriate activities. The content aligns with Common Core and state standards, making it a practical resource for both home and classroom use.
